Et les rappeurs chantèrent Senghor ou un exemple d’adaptation intermédiale de la négritude

This paper explores an unprecedented artistic experience initiated by African rappers in 2007. Using the poems written by the Senegalese poet Léopold Sédar Senghor, they adapted them to rap music.
